Jony Ive jacket reinvents the button (with magnets)

Jony Ive’s jacket assortment for Moncler revolves round a vest with numerous outer layers connected by magnets.
Picture: Moncler/LoveFrom

Ive’s San Francisco design collective, LoveFrom, created the brand new jackets in collaboration with Moncler, a luxurious Italian outside model finest recognized for extravagant black-and-white puffer jackets. The LoveFrom, Moncler assortment revolves round a base-layer vest, to which a wide range of outer shells could be magnetically connected.

The vest is down-filled and is available in yellow or off-white. The pastel-colored outer layers embrace a hooded poncho, a discipline jacket and a parka.

The design collaboration goes again 4 years. As an alternative of utilizing zips of Velcro, Ive and Moncler spent 18 months alone designing a brand new sort of magnetic button that really sounds extremely cool and intelligent.

How the magnetic duo button works

The progressive “duo button” is made up of two metallic items — sort of like a donut and a donut gap — which pull themselves collectively magnetically when in shut proximity to one another.

5 duo buttons seem on every layer, all in the identical place. Merely pulling the highest layer over the vest attaches the 2 components of the garment. As a result of the buttons align themselves naturally, they mechanically be a part of with a collection of satisfying pops.

“When you put the shell on top, you don’t fix anything. It’s like, ‘pop pop pop!’” the CEO of Moncler instructed Quick Firm, which bought a preview of the gathering.

The magnetic button works “uncannily well,” the journal stated.

“We did months and months of fastener research and button research before we even started drawing anything,” Ive instructed Vogue journal.

The buttons are additionally simple to undo: Simply press on the center half and it comes undone. Ive’s workforce even paid consideration to the sound the button made. They rigorously tuned the combo of bronze, aluminum and metal till it produced probably the most satisfying click on doable.

Jony Ive’s ‘fiddle factor’ in a jacket

Jony Ive’s jacket assortment for Moncler features a poncho constructed from a single sheet of recycled nylon.

The duo buttons on the jackets ship Jony Ive’s unmistakable “fiddle factor” — a tactile attraction that makes individuals wish to contact and fiddle with Ive’s designs.

Early in his profession, earlier than becoming a member of Apple, Ive’s fellow designers observed that a lot of his creations proved enjoyable to fiddle with. For instance, a ballpoint pen he designed for a Japanese firm featured a spring mechanism that individuals fiddled with nearly addictively. It made the pen particularly fascinating.

The fiddle issue additionally outlined a variety of Ive’s designs at Apple. The primary iMac got here with a deal with — not for transferring the pc, however for signaling to a potential purchaser that it was OK to the touch the machine. Ive felt it made the iMac much less intimidating. The iPod‘s click wheel offered a very high fiddle factor, too. And the iPhone, of course, is all about touching (all detailed in my book, Jony Ive: The Genius Behind Apple’s Best Merchandise).

The Moncler jacket’s new duo button additionally sounds enjoyable to fiddle with. It “is the most satisfying, addictive, fidget-spinner of a button I’ve ever used,” stated Quick Firm. “As Ive, Ruffini, and I talk, I notice that we’re each holding the duo button, compulsively clicking it together and pushing it apart again and again.”

LoveFrom, Moncler assortment: Revolutionary supplies, unknown pricing

After all, every little thing else within the assortment went by way of a equally exhaustive design course of. They even developed a brand new sort of recycled nylon, then found out how you can make sheets of it on big looms.

The LoveFrom, Moncler assortment goes on sale September 24 in choose shops, and on-line in October. Pricing stays undisclosed for Jony Ive’s new jacket, however it doubtless will value a small fortune. You recognize the previous phrase: If you must ask, you in all probability can’t afford it.
